Embodiment 1

[0042] Embodiment 1 of the present invention provides a dicing tape for wafer processing, including a substrate layer and an adhesive layer;

[0043] The raw materials for the preparation of the adhesive layer include 95 parts of olefinic acid, 5 parts of crosslinking agent and 50 parts of polyurethane;

[0044] The raw materials for the preparation of the adhesive layer also include a photopolymerization initiator, and the ratio of the photopolymerization initiator to the olefinic acid substance is 0.045:1;

[0045] Alkenoic acids include methacrylic acid, 3-hydroxyoct-7-enoic acid and 5-(3,4-dihydroxyphenyl)-2,4-pentadienoic acid, methacrylic acid, 3-hydroxyoct-7- The weight ratio of 7-enoic acid and 5-(3,4-dihydroxyphenyl)-2,4-pentadienoic acid is 5:2.5:1;

[0046] The crosslinking agent is 1,3-phenylene diisocyanate;

Abstract

Relating to the field of adhesive tapes, the invention more specifically provides a cutting adhesive tape for wafer processing and a preparation method thereof. The invention on the first aspect provides a cutting adhesive tape for wafer processing, the cutting adhesive tape includes a substrate layer and an adhesive layer, wherein the raw materials for preparation of the adhesive layer include olefine acid substances, a cross-linking agent and polyurethane, and the olefine acid substances include methacrylic acid and 3-hydroxyoctyl-7-olefine acid.

Description

technical field [0001] The invention relates to the field of tapes, and more specifically, the invention provides a dicing tape for wafer processing and a preparation method thereof. Background technique [0002] Recently, thinning and miniaturization of semiconductor devices and their packages have been increasingly demanded. Therefore, as the semiconductor device and its package, a flip chip type semiconductor device in which a semiconductor element such as a semiconductor chip is mounted (flip chip connected) on a substrate by flip chip bonding has been widely utilized. In such flip-chip connection, a semiconductor chip is fixed to a substrate in such a manner that the circuit face of the semiconductor chip is opposed to the electrode-forming face of the substrate.
